What theme is developed in BOTH “After Twenty Years” and “Hawk”?

English
1 answer:
Nimfa-mama [501]1 year ago
7 0

The theme with acts as a text-to-text connection between "After Twenty Years" and "Hawk" is "People with integrity remain true to themselves" (Option D)

<h3>Who wrote "After Twenty Years"?</h3>

William Sydney Porter, better known as O. Henry, was an American writer most known for his short tales, though he also authored poetry and non-fiction.

His works include the novels such as:

  • Cabbages and Kings,
  • "The Gift of the Magi,"
  • "The Duplicity of Hargraves," and
  • "The Ransom of Red Chief."

He wrote the book "After Twenty Years."

<h3>Who wrote Hawk?</h3>

James Brendan Patterson is a writer from the United States.

His work includes the Alex Cross, Michael Bennett, Women's Murder Club, Maximum Ride, Daniel X, NYPD Red, Witch and Wizard, and Private series, as well as several stand-alone thrillers, non-fiction, and romantic novels.

Hawk was written by him.
